Company overview

Shuart & Associates is a legal recruitment firm that has been serving law firms and corporate legal departments in Louisiana and Texas for over 30 years. The company specializes in helping clients hire the right talent, including attorneys and legal support staff, through strategic recruitment solutions. Headquartered in New Orleans, LA, Shuart & Associates also operates in Mandeville, LA, and Austin, TX. Their services include legal search and staffing, and they have a strong reputation for confidentiality and professionalism in the legal community.
